Search for a Heavy Particle Decaying into an Electron and a Muon with the ATLAS Detector in s=7 TeV pp collisions at the LHC

Abstract

This Letter presents the first search for a heavy particle decaying into an e ± μ(-/+) final state in sqrt[s] = 7 TeV pp collisions at the LHC. The data were recorded by the ATLAS detector during 2010 and correspond to a total integrated luminosity of 35 pb(-1). No excess above the standard model background expectation is observed.
